Abstract
The objectives of the program were to evaluate the light transmission approach to monitoring particulate pollution and to determine the reliability and degree of correlation of the transmissometer and other particulate measurement methods in a variety of industrial environments. The six industrial environments were as follows: (1) A petroleum refinery catalytic cracking unit catalyst regenerator, (2) Sewage treatment plant incinerator for sludge burning, (3) Asphaltic concrete plant (hot mix), (4/5) Secondary brass and lead smelter, (6) Oil fired power plant. The scope of work required that a commercially available transmissometer be tested at each site for 30 days and its performance evaluated as a continuous monitor of the in-stack opacity, plume opacity and in-stack mass concentration. Data were also obtained on the spectral transmission characteristics and size distribution of the particulate emissions of the plants.
